Tiefling Tracker: Role Synergies & Approaches
Combining the intrinsic abilities of a Tiefling with the proficient expertise of a Ranger creates a truly dangerous adventurer in any adventure. This unique mix allows for a variety of methods, from a silent ambusher to a deadly archer. Consider leveraging your Tiefling's low-light vision and resistance to fire alongside Ranger subclasses like the Gloom Stalker for superior damage production and tracking skills. Remember to prioritize Dexterity and Wisdom for greatest effectiveness. A well-crafted build can make your Tiefling Ranger a essential asset to any group.
